How To Fix CRMS4_COMPL005 - Reference type &1 is not valid.


CRMS4_COMPL005 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RMS4_COMPL - Output for Complanits

  • Message number: 005

  • Message text: Reference type &1 is not valid.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CRMS4_COMPL005 - Reference type &1 is not valid. ?
    The SAP error message CRMS4_COMPL005 indicates that there is an issue with the reference type specified in a CRM (Customer Relationship Management) context. Specifically, the message states that the reference type (&1) is not valid. This error typically occurs when trying to create or process a document (like a complaint, service request, etc.) that references an invalid or non-existent object type.
    Causes:
    
    Incorrect Reference Type: The reference type specified in the transaction or document is not recognized by the system. This could be due to a typo or an outdated reference type.
    
    Configuration Issues: The reference type may not be properly configured in the system. This could happen if the reference type was deleted or if the configuration settings were changed. Data Inconsistencies: There may be inconsistencies in the data, such as missing entries in the relevant tables that define valid reference types.
